NACL Industries Limited held its 39th Annual General Meeting on July 22, 2026, approving the audited financial statements for the year ended March 31, 2026, and revising the remuneration of its Managing Director & Chief Executive Officer. The meeting, convened via video conferencing, was presided over by Chairman Mr. Arun Alagappan and included the re-appointment of a director and the ratification of cost auditor fees.

The Board confirmed that the Statutory Auditors' Report contained no qualifications, observations, or comments adversely affecting the company's operations. However, qualifications in the Secretarial Auditors' Report were addressed, with the Board providing appropriate explanations in its report. The Chairman highlighted the company's strategic focus on "Stabilize" and "Build" to navigate industry volatility and drive operational recovery.

Resolutions Passed

Shareholders voted on five items of business, including four ordinary resolutions and one special resolution. The remote e-voting facility was available from July 19 to July 21, 2026, with Mr. R. Sridharan of R. Sridharan & Associates appointed as the Scrutinizer.

Resolution Type Description
Ordinary Adoption of Audited Standalone Financial Statements for FY26
Ordinary Adoption of Audited Consolidated Financial Statements for FY26
Ordinary Re-appointment of Mr. Sankarasubramanian S, Non-Executive Director
Ordinary Ratification of Cost Auditor remuneration for FY27
Special Revision of remuneration for Dr. Raghuram Devarakonda, MD & CEO

Key Attendees and Governance

The meeting was attended by key personnel, including Dr. Raghuram Devarakonda, Managing Director & CEO, Mr. N. Shankar, Chief Financial Officer, and Mr. Rajesh Mukhija, Company Secretary. Several independent directors joined via video conferencing from Chennai. Representatives from M/s. S.R. Batliboi & Associates LLP (Statutory Auditors), M/s. Sridharan & Associates (Secretarial Auditors), and M/s. Narasimha Murthy & Co (Cost Auditors) were also present.

The Chairman noted that the Register of Directors, Key Managerial Personnel shareholding, and Register of Contracts were available for inspection. Additionally, the Secretarial Auditor's certificate confirming compliance with SEBI regulations regarding Employee Stock Option Schemes was made accessible to members.

NACL Industries Limited reported a standalone net profit of ₹23.57 crore for the quarter ended June 30, 2026, marking a 64.8% increase from ₹14.30 crore in the corresponding period of the previous year. Revenue from operations for Q1FY27 stood at ₹382.25 crore, while total income was ₹384.26 crore. The Board of Directors approved the unaudited financial results on July 22, 2026.

Financial Performance

The company's EBITDA for the quarter stood at ₹414 million, up from ₹381 million in the same period last year, reflecting improved operational efficiency. EBITDA margin expanded meaningfully to 10.8% from 8.51% on a year-on-year basis. On a consolidated basis, net profit rose to ₹20.84 crore from ₹13.04 crore in Q1FY26, while consolidated revenue from operations was ₹383.33 crore compared to ₹448.36 crore in the prior year period. The basic and diluted earnings per share (EPS) for the standalone entity were recorded at ₹1.01 for the quarter, up from ₹0.66 in the same period last year.

The table below summarises the key financial metrics for the quarter:

Metric Standalone Q1FY27 (₹ in Lakhs) Standalone Q1FY26 (₹ in Lakhs) Consolidated Q1FY27 (₹ in Lakhs) Consolidated Q1FY26 (₹ in Lakhs)
Revenue from Operations 38,225 43,850 38,333 44,836
Total Income 38,426 44,077 38,522 44,953
Net Profit 2,357 1,430 2,084 1,304
Basic EPS (₹) 1.01 0.66 0.89 0.60
EBITDA Metric Q1FY27 Q1FY26
EBITDA ₹414 million ₹381 million
EBITDA Margin 10.80% 8.51%

Strategic Divestment

The Board approved the proposal to divest the company's entire equity stake in Nasense Labs Private Limited, an associate company. The stake will be sold to Mr. Kanumuru Satyanarayana Raju for a total consideration of ₹8,15,29,967. The transaction is expected to be completed within the next three months, subject to the fulfilment of terms and conditions outlined in the Share Purchase Agreement. Post-completion, Nasense Labs Private Limited will cease to be an associate company of NACL Industries Limited.

Operational Details

The unaudited financial results were reviewed by M/s. S R Batliboi & Associates, Statutory Auditors of the company, who issued an unmodified conclusion. The company also reported that funds raised through a rights issue in December 2025 have been utilised for the intended purposes, with an unutilised amount of ₹2,445 lakhs deposited in an earmarked bank account. Additionally, the company allotted 65,000 equity shares during the quarter pursuant to the exercise of stock options.
